新聞中心
求助:如何在Oracle數(shù)據(jù)庫(kù)中進(jìn)行求和操作?

成都創(chuàng)新互聯(lián)公司是一家專注于成都做網(wǎng)站、成都網(wǎng)站制作與策劃設(shè)計(jì),石臺(tái)網(wǎng)站建設(shè)哪家好?成都創(chuàng)新互聯(lián)公司做網(wǎng)站,專注于網(wǎng)站建設(shè)10余年,網(wǎng)設(shè)計(jì)領(lǐng)域的專業(yè)建站公司;建站業(yè)務(wù)涵蓋:石臺(tái)等地區(qū)。石臺(tái)做網(wǎng)站價(jià)格咨詢:18982081108
在Oracle數(shù)據(jù)庫(kù)中進(jìn)行求和操作,是數(shù)據(jù)庫(kù)開發(fā)和管理者經(jīng)常需要面對(duì)的問題。求和操作是數(shù)據(jù)庫(kù)中最基本的操作之一,也是對(duì)數(shù)據(jù)進(jìn)行計(jì)算和分析的必備工具。本文將介紹如何在Oracle數(shù)據(jù)庫(kù)中進(jìn)行求和操作,包括使用SQL語(yǔ)句和函數(shù)的方法。
SQL語(yǔ)句求和操作:
SQL語(yǔ)句是Oracle數(shù)據(jù)庫(kù)中最基本也是最常用的操作手段。通過SQL語(yǔ)句可以對(duì)數(shù)據(jù)庫(kù)中的表進(jìn)行各種數(shù)據(jù)操作,包括查詢、插入、修改、刪除、合并等。在Oracle數(shù)據(jù)庫(kù)中,可以使用SUM函數(shù)對(duì)表中的數(shù)據(jù)進(jìn)行求和操作。
語(yǔ)法如下:
SELECT SUM(column_name) FROM table_name;
其中,column_name表示要求和的列名,table_name表示要操作的表名。例如,我們要對(duì)一張名為orders的訂單表中的總金額sum_price進(jìn)行求和操作,SQL語(yǔ)句如下:
SELECT SUM(sum_price) FROM orders;
這將返回訂單表中sum_price列的總和。我們也可以在這個(gè)SELECT語(yǔ)句中使用WHERE子句來過濾出符合條件的數(shù)據(jù)。例如,我們要求出訂單表中2023年的總銷售額,SQL語(yǔ)句如下:
SELECT SUM(sum_price) FROM orders WHERE order_date BETWEEN ‘2023-01-01’ AND ‘2023-12-31’;
這將返回訂單表中order_date列在2023年內(nèi)的sum_price列的總和。
SQL函數(shù)求和操作:
在Oracle數(shù)據(jù)庫(kù)中,也可以使用SQL函數(shù)來進(jìn)行求和操作。SQL函數(shù)是預(yù)先定義好的計(jì)算操作,可以快速地執(zhí)行數(shù)學(xué)和邏輯計(jì)算。在Oracle數(shù)據(jù)庫(kù)中,可以使用SUM()函數(shù)對(duì)表中的數(shù)據(jù)進(jìn)行求和操作。
語(yǔ)法如下:
SUM(column_name);
其中,column_name表示要求和的列名。例如,我們要對(duì)一張名為orders的訂單表中的總金額sum_price進(jìn)行求和操作,SQL函數(shù)如下:
SUM(sum_price);
這將返回訂單表中sum_price列的總和。我們也可以在SQL函數(shù)中使用GROUP BY子句來對(duì)查詢結(jié)果按指定列進(jìn)行分組。例如,我們要對(duì)訂單表中按2023年月份進(jìn)行分組來求出每個(gè)月的銷售額,SQL語(yǔ)句如下:
SELECT TO_CHAR(order_date, ‘yyyy-mm’), SUM(sum_price) FROM orders WHERE order_date BETWEEN ‘2023-01-01’ AND ‘2023-12-31’ GROUP BY TO_CHAR(order_date, ‘yyyy-mm’);
這將返回訂單表中2023年每個(gè)月的sum_price列的總和。
綜上所述,Oracle數(shù)據(jù)庫(kù)中進(jìn)行求和操作是非常簡(jiǎn)單的,可以使用SQL語(yǔ)句和函數(shù)的方法。無論是基本的求和操作,還是復(fù)雜的數(shù)據(jù)分析,都可以通過Oracle數(shù)據(jù)庫(kù)輕松完成。在實(shí)際應(yīng)用中,我們可以靈活運(yùn)用這些方法,對(duì)數(shù)據(jù)進(jìn)行高效的管理和優(yōu)化。
相關(guān)問題拓展閱讀:
- Oracle數(shù)據(jù)求和
- oracle中列中的數(shù)據(jù)求和
Oracle數(shù)據(jù)求和
單從你給的數(shù)據(jù)來看應(yīng)該這么寫,但我感覺也許這個(gè)英文中文和編碼應(yīng)該有個(gè)其野晌蔽他關(guān)系表,如果有的話你可以謹(jǐn)虧關(guān)聯(lián)這個(gè)關(guān)系表,然頌州后將不一樣的字段統(tǒng)一成名稱在求和
不是太理解你意思,者橘達(dá)到第二個(gè)表就直接加條件就好了,select ‘英語(yǔ)’首亮團(tuán) as 學(xué)科, sum(及格人數(shù)) 及格人數(shù) from t where t.學(xué)科 in (‘英語(yǔ)’ ,鍵攔’english’);這樣就可以了
oracle中列中的數(shù)據(jù)求和
select sum(A) from 表名
select sum(A) from 表名; 這個(gè)薯運(yùn)者語(yǔ)數(shù)薯句,要達(dá)到你們目的,除非你這個(gè)表中只有這三行數(shù)據(jù)。悄掘
關(guān)于oracle數(shù)據(jù)庫(kù) 求和的介紹到此就結(jié)束了,不知道你從中找到你需要的信息了嗎 ?如果你還想了解更多這方面的信息,記得收藏關(guān)注本站。
成都創(chuàng)新互聯(lián)科技有限公司,是一家專注于互聯(lián)網(wǎng)、IDC服務(wù)、應(yīng)用軟件開發(fā)、網(wǎng)站建設(shè)推廣的公司,為客戶提供互聯(lián)網(wǎng)基礎(chǔ)服務(wù)!
創(chuàng)新互聯(lián)(www.cdcxhl.com)提供簡(jiǎn)單好用,價(jià)格厚道的香港/美國(guó)云服務(wù)器和獨(dú)立服務(wù)器。創(chuàng)新互聯(lián)成都老牌IDC服務(wù)商,專注四川成都IDC機(jī)房服務(wù)器托管/機(jī)柜租用。為您精選優(yōu)質(zhì)idc數(shù)據(jù)中心機(jī)房租用、服務(wù)器托管、機(jī)柜租賃、大帶寬租用,可選線路電信、移動(dòng)、聯(lián)通等。
文章名稱:【求助:如何在Oracle數(shù)據(jù)庫(kù)中進(jìn)行求和操作?】(oracle數(shù)據(jù)庫(kù)求和)
文章出自:http://m.5511xx.com/article/coohchh.html


咨詢
建站咨詢
